INGLETON rocked to the sound of the Eliza Carthy Band last Saturday night when they topped the bill at the third Ingleton Folk Weekend. A capacity audience at the Community Centre was treated to a virtuoso performance by the young folk singer and fiddle player who was backed by top flight musicians John Spiers, Jon Boden and Ben Ivitsky. Community Centre manager David Butters said: “It was certainly a night to remember. Terrific.” Organisers estimate that more than 1,500 people took part in at least one of the many events.

There were workshops for Appalachian dancing and fiddle playing and the pubs were alive with impromptu music sessions.
